Latest Patents

Nakamura holds a patent for a solar cell element manufacturing method, solar cell element, and solar cell module. This patent describes a method for manufacturing a solar cell element that includes two different etching processes followed by the formation of a semiconductor layer. The process begins with etching a semiconductor substrate of the first conductor type using a first acid aqueous solution containing hydrofluoric acid, nitric acid, and sulfuric acid. Subsequently, the substrate is etched with a second acid aqueous solution that contains hydrofluoric acid and nitric acid, but with substantially no sulfuric acid, to create an uneven surface. Finally, a semiconductor layer of a second conductivity type, which is different from the first, is formed on at least a part of the uneven surface of the semiconductor substrate.
